Product Introduction

Overview

The TJA1043ATK/0Y, produced by NXP USA Inc., is a high-speed CAN (Controller Area Network) transceiver designed for high-speed CAN applications, particularly in the automotive industry. This transceiver provides an interface between a CAN protocol controller and the physical two-wire CAN bus, ensuring reliable communication in accordance with the ISO 11898-2:2016 and SAE J2284-1 to SAE J2284-5 standards. It belongs to the third generation of high-speed CAN transceivers from NXP Semiconductors, offering significant improvements in ElectroMagnetic Compatibility (EMC), ElectroStatic Discharge (ESD) performance, and power management compared to earlier generations like the TJA1041A.

Key Specifications

Parameter Conditions Min Typ Max Unit
VCC supply voltage 4.5 5.5 V
VIO supply voltage on pin VIO 2.8 5.5 V
Undervoltage detection voltage on pin VCC (Vuvd(VCC)) 3 3.5 4.3 V
Undervoltage detection voltage on pin VIO (Vuvd(VIO)) VBAT or VCC > 4.5 V 0.8 1.8 2.5 V
ICC supply current (Normal mode; bus dominant) 30 48 65 mA
ICC supply current (Normal or Listen-only mode; bus recessive) 3 6 9 mA
ICC supply current (Standby or Sleep mode) 0 0.75 2 μA
IIO supply current on pin VIO (Normal mode; VTXD = 0 V (dominant)) - 150 500 μA
IIO supply current on pin VIO (Normal or Listen-only mode; VTXD = VIO (recessive)) 0 1 4 μA
IIO supply current on pin VIO (Standby or Sleep mode) 0 1 4 μA
Data Rate 5 Mbps
Operating Temperature -40°C 150°C (TJ)

Key Features

  • Compliance with ISO 11898-2:2016 and SAE J2284-1 to SAE J2284-5 standards, enabling reliable communication at data rates up to 5 Mbit/s in the CAN FD fast phase.
  • Improved ElectroMagnetic Compatibility (EMC) and ElectroStatic Discharge (ESD) performance.
  • Very low power consumption with advanced power management features, including low-current Standby and Sleep modes, and local and remote wake-up capabilities.
  • Suitable for 12 V and 24 V systems.
  • Low ElectroMagnetic Emission (EME) and high ElectroMagnetic Immunity (EMI).
  • VIO input allows for direct interfacing with 3 V and 5 V microcontrollers.
  • SPLIT voltage output for stabilizing the recessive bus level.
  • Listen-only mode for node diagnosis and failure containment.
  • Available in SO14 and HVSON14 packages, with the HVSON14 package offering improved Automated Optical Inspection (AOI) capability.
  • AEC-Q100 qualified and compliant with RoHS and halogen-free standards.
  • Advanced protection and diagnostic functions, including bus line short-circuit detection, battery connection detection, and thermal protection with diagnosis.

Applications

The TJA1043ATK/0Y is primarily designed for high-speed CAN applications in the automotive industry. It is ideal for use in various automotive systems that require reliable and efficient communication, such as:

  • Vehicle network systems.
  • Driver assistance systems.
  • Engine control units.
  • Transmission control units.
  • Infotainment systems.
  • Advanced safety features like airbag systems and anti-lock braking systems (ABS).
